Senior software engineer focused on stability issues in Qualcomm embedded and multi-processor environments. Investigates and debugs stability problems across chipsets, using methods such as code inspection, log analysis, tracing, JTAG and ETM. Works with development, test and customer teams to resolve issues, develops tools and training to improve stability processes, and communicates findings through reports and reviews.

Responsibilities

• Investigate and debug software stability issues found in various Qualcomm chipsets covering multi-processor, multi-RTOS systems.
• Typical issues include coding and algorithmic bugs, resource exhaustion, stack and heap corruptions, SW and HW watchdogs, HW misconfiguration.
• Maintain expert-level knowledge of SW debugging methods and apply them judiciously to quickly resolve stability issues.
• Methods include code inspection and instrumentation, SW log analysis, SW tracing, JTAG, ETM, Oscilloscopes.
• Understand wireless communications technologies used in Qualcomm chipsets such as C2K, GSM, UMTS, LTE, TDS-CDMA, NR5G, ,WiFi, Bluetooth, NFC.
• Work with development, test and customer engineering teams to resolve stability issues using processor simulators as well as live hardware.
• Represent stability team in various cross-team efforts such as chip bring-up, debugging in customer site and feature design discussions.
• Develop tools, scripts and training material to help improve stability process. •
• Discuss technical analysis of stability issues and provide status through reports, scrum meetings and management reviews.
